There was a robbery in Tsim Sha Tsui. At about 8 pm today (18th), the police received a report from a staff member of the Celebrity Watch and Jewellery "Celebrity Station" at No. 55 Hankow Road, claiming that the thieves had stolen 3 watches with a total value of more than 800,000 yuan , the staff tried to catch the thief to no avail, and injured his hand, after which the thief boarded a private car and fled.
Staff are not required to be sent to hospital after examination.
According to on-site information, a male suspect pretended to be a guest, entered the store and asked the staff to take out three Rolex watches, then took the opportunity to grab it and ran out of the door, and boarded a private car driven by another party member and fled. .
The case is temporarily classified as a robbery, and police are investigating the incident at the scene.
